Pursuit of Life
This book is a poetic telling of a love that didn't die with death and that living couldn't extinguish until time brought it full circle. As the author puts it, "This book is kinda, sorta my life story." Commencing just moments after his birth, he takes you on an imaginary journey through his childhood, his subsequent 20 year marriage to Christine, her death, then through his struggles to overcome despair and finally to the pinnacle of new love. You are there from the very beginning, where he states: "After nine months of darkness in a tiny 98 degree room, suddenly it's 68 and very bright, as I come out of the womb. I've nothing but the air I breathe and not a stitch of clothing. They spank me on the butt and that really starts me loathing."
